The lasses were crying and wringing their hands,

Saying the Rout it is come for the Blues.

Dolly unto her old mother did say,

"My heart's full of love that is true;"

She packed up her clothes without more delay,

To take the last leave of the Blues.

Our landlords and landladys walk arm in arm,

And so does the young women too,

You'd have laughed if you'd seen how the lasses flocked in,

To take the last leave of the Blues.
